The NIKE Hercules System: A Cold War Sentinel

The MIM-14 Nike Hercules was a surface-to-air missile system that defined a crucial era in air defense. Developed by the United States Army during the Cold War, the Nike Hercules represented a significant advancement in missile technology. Its solid-fuel propulsion system provided a reliable and powerful launch, capable of intercepting high-altitude bombers posing a threat to American and allied territories. This system, a product of the intense arms race, was a vital component in the broader strategy of deterring Soviet aggression.

Nike Hercules: The heart of the system was the missile itself, a sophisticated piece of weaponry capable of reaching impressive altitudes and ranges. Its effectiveness stemmed from a combination of factors: the powerful solid-fuel rocket motor, the advanced guidance system that allowed for accurate targeting, and the warhead capable of destroying enemy aircraft. The Hercules was a significant improvement over its predecessor, the Nike Ajax, offering greater range and altitude capability. This made it suitable for defending against a wider variety of threats, including high-flying strategic bombers.

Hercules Functional Description: The Nike Hercules system was far more than just the missile. It comprised a complex network of components working in concert. This included:

* Launchers: These housed the missiles and provided the infrastructure for launching them. They were often sited in groups, creating a layered defense.

* Radars: A network of sophisticated radars was crucial for detecting incoming aircraft and tracking their movements, providing the necessary targeting information for the missiles. These radars had to be capable of detecting targets at long ranges and high altitudes.

* Control Centers: These were the nerve centers of the system, integrating information from the radars and directing the launch and guidance of the missiles. Highly trained personnel were essential to the effective operation of these centers.

* Support Infrastructure: Maintaining a Nike Hercules site required significant logistical support, including transportation, power generation, and communication systems. The sheer scale of these sites reflected the importance placed on air defense.
